Chinese president congratulates Zardari on being elected Pakistani president

  BEIJING, Sept. 7 (Xinhua) -- Chinese President Hu Jintao extended his sincere congratulations and well wishes to newly elected Pakistani President Asif Ali Zardari on Sunday.

  China and Pakistan are friendly neighbors that are joined by common mountains and rivers, and peoples of the two countries have developed an all-weather friendship, said Hu in a congratulatory message.

  In the last 57 years since the establishment of the bilateral ties, the two sides trust each other and treat each other as equals politically, share a mutually beneficial cooperation and common development economically, and enjoy remarkably fruitful and ever expanding exchanges and cooperation in other fields, Hu said.

  When dealing with international and regional affairs, the two countries support each other and hold coordination closely, he said.

  The Sino-Pakistani friendship brings about real interests to the two peoples and makes active contributions to peace, stability and development of the region and the world as a whole, he said.

  In the new historical period, China is willing to join hands with Pakistan to carry forward the traditional friendship, to jointly create a bright future, to promote the Sino-Pakistani strategic cooperative partnership to a new level, and to be good neighbors, good friends, good brothers and good partners forever, Hu added.
